Melanotan II 10mg is a synthetic analog of the naturally occurring alpha-melanocyte-stimulating hormone (α-MSH), a peptide involved in regulating pigmentation and other physiological processes.
This compound is primarily studied for its interaction with melanocortin receptors (MC receptors), which are involved in skin pigmentation pathways. In research settings, Melanotan II has been shown to influence melanin production, making it a compound of interest in studies related to pigmentation response and UV-related skin mechanisms.
Beyond pigmentation, melanocortin receptors are also involved in a variety of biological processes, including appetite regulation and other central signaling pathways. Because of this, Melanotan II has been explored in broader research models examining receptor activity and systemic signaling effects.
Its stability and potency have made it a widely recognized compound within peptide research environments focused on receptor-based mechanisms.
